What are ISO Standards and Their Importance?

Introduction to ISO Standards

  • ISO standards are documents that outline guidelines, rules, and requirements for organizing specific aspects of an organization, such as safety, environmental management, and quality.
  • The term "ISO" stands for the International Organization for Standardization, which is responsible for creating these standards.

History and Structure of ISO

  • Established in 1947, ISO has published over 20,000 international standards across various sectors focused on manufacturing, marketing, and communication.
  • ISO comprises national standardization bodies from 164 member countries; each country has its own national body (e.g., INDECOPI in Peru).

Development Process of ISO Standards

  • The creation of an ISO standard arises from market needs rather than arbitrary decisions by the organization.
  • Committees composed of experts from member countries collaborate to draft these standards through a lengthy process involving project initiation, review, analysis, and evaluation.

Recognized ISO Standards

  • The most recognized standard is ISO 9001, which sets requirements for a quality management system aimed at ensuring customer satisfaction.
  • Other notable standards include:
  • ISO 14001: Focuses on environmental protection.
  • ISO 22000: Pertains to food safety management systems.
  • ISO 45001: Addresses occupational health and safety.

Classification of ISO Standards

  • Standards are categorized into families. For example:
  • ISO 9000 Family: Covers fundamentals and vocabulary related to quality management systems.
  • ISO 9001: Only certifiable standard within this family.
  • ISO 9004: Provides guidelines for improving quality management performance.
  • The ISO 14000 Family deals with environmental issues while the ISO 45000 Series focuses on workplace health and safety.
